.hide{display:none!important}.stock-display__container{margin:20px auto;width:100%}stock-display{display:flex;flex-direction:column;gap:12px}.stock-display{background-color:#fff;border:1px solid #BDBFC3;border-radius:4px;font-size:14px;line-height:1.2;padding:16px}.stock-display .btn{font-size:inherit}.stock-display .btn.btn-link{font-family:inherit;padding:0;text-decoration:none}.stock-display__row{display:flex;justify-content:space-between}.stock-display__label{display:inline-flex;align-items:center;column-gap:8px}.stock-display__row.delivery{margin-bottom:16px}.stock-display__store-header{display:flex;align-items:center;justify-content:space-between;gap:24px;margin-bottom:12px;flex-wrap:wrap}@media(max-width:767px){.stock-display__store-header{gap:12px;flex-direction:column;align-items:flex-start}}.stock-display__store-info{display:flex;align-items:center;gap:12px}.stock-display__store-icon{display:inline-flex;align-items:center}.stock-display__store-icon .icon{width:18px;height:16px}.stock-display__store-text{display:flex;gap:6px;font-size:14px;line-height:1.2;letter-spacing:.07px}.stock-display__store-label,.stock-display__store-name{font-weight:400}.stock-display__store-header .stock-display__cta{display:flex;align-items:center;gap:8px;font-size:12px;white-space:nowrap}.stock-display__availability-section{display:flex;flex-direction:column;gap:8px}.stock-display__availability-item{display:flex;align-items:center;gap:8px;min-height:21px}.stock-display__indicator-dot{width:10px;height:10px;border-radius:50%;background-color:#68c090;flex-shrink:0}.stock-display__availability-item[data-status=unavailable] .stock-display__indicator-dot,.stock-display__availability-item[data-status=out-of-stock] .stock-display__indicator-dot,.stock-display__availability-item[data-status=call-store] .stock-display__indicator-dot{background-color:#cf102d}.stock-display__availability-item[data-status=""] .stock-display__indicator-dot,.stock-display__availability-item[data-status=check-store] .stock-display__indicator-dot{background-color:#bdbfc3}.stock-display__indicator-label{font-size:12px;line-height:1.2;color:#000}.stock-display__indicator-value{display:none}.stock-display__row.store-check{display:flex;justify-content:space-between;align-items:center;gap:12px;flex-wrap:wrap}.stock-display__check-label{display:flex;align-items:center;gap:12px}.stock-display__check-label .stock-display__store-icon{display:inline-flex;align-items:center}.stock-display__check-label .stock-display__store-icon .icon{width:18px;height:16px}.stock-display__check-text{font-size:14px;line-height:1.2;letter-spacing:.07px;font-weight:400}.stock-display__row.store-check .stock-display__cta{display:flex;align-items:center;gap:2px;font-size:12px;white-space:nowrap}.stock-display__message-container{margin-top:12px}.stock-display__value{font-size:12px}.stock-display__status{align-items:center;display:inline-flex;font-size:12px;font-weight:400;line-height:1.2;gap:8px;white-space:nowrap}.stock-display__status .stock-display__dot{display:block;border-radius:10px;height:10px;width:10px}.in-stock .stock-display__dot{background-color:#68c090}.out-of-stock .stock-display__dot{background-color:#737373}.available .stock-display__dot{background-color:#68c090}.unavailable .stock-display__dot{background-color:#cf102d}.stock-display__icon{margin-left:3px}.btn .stock-display__icon .icon{top:0}.stock-display__icon .icon{fill:none;height:17px;width:17px}.stock-display__placeholder:empty~.stock-display__cta{display:inline-block!important}.stock-display__cta .icon-chevron-down{top:0;transition:all .3s ease 0s}.collapsible-open .stock-display__cta .icon-chevron-down{transform:rotate(180deg)}.stock-display__text-underline{border-bottom:1px solid #000000;padding-bottom:2px;line-height:1.2}.stock-display__message:not(:empty){color:#cf102d;margin-top:12px;letter-spacing:.07px;line-height:1.2}.stock-display__collapsible{text-align:left}.stock-display__toolbar{text-align:left;line-height:normal;margin-top:12px}.stock-display__form{margin:0;max-width:100%}.stock-display__form select{box-sizing:border-box;height:54px;width:100%}.stock-display__form select,.stock-display .choices{margin-bottom:12px;width:100%}.stock-display__form select:last-child,.stock-display .choices:last-child{margin-bottom:0}.stock-display .choices__inner{background-color:#fff;border-color:#e2e2e2;border-radius:4px;min-height:54px;padding:12px}.stock-display .is-focused .choices__inner,.stock-display .is-open .choices__inner{border-color:#000}.stock-display .choices__list--dropdown .choices__item,.stock-display .choices__list[aria-expanded] .choices__item{border-radius:4px;padding:12px}.stock-display .choices__item{align-items:center;display:flex;justify-content:space-between;gap:10px}.stock-display .choices__list--single{color:#737373}.stock-display .choices__placeholder{opacity:1}.stock-display .choices[data-type*=select-one]:after{background-image:url(data:image/svg+xml;base64,PHN2ZyB3aWR0aD0iMjAiIGhlaWdodD0iMjAiIHZpZXdCb3g9IjAgMCAyMCAyMCIgZmlsbD0ibm9uZSIgeG1sbnM9Imh0dHA6Ly93d3cudzMub3JnLzIwMDAvc3ZnIj4KPGcgaWQ9ImNoZXZyb24tZG93biI+CjxwYXRoIGlkPSJWZWN0b3IiIGQ9Ik01IDcuNUwxMCAxMi41TDE1IDcuNSIgc3Ryb2tlPSJibGFjayIgc3Ryb2tlLXdpZHRoPSIxLjUiIHN0cm9rZS1saW5lY2FwPSJyb3VuZCIgc3Ryb2tlLWxpbmVqb2luPSJyb3VuZCIvPgo8L2c+Cjwvc3ZnPgo=);border:none;margin-top:-10px;height:20px;transition:all ease-in-out .3s;width:20px}.stock-display .choices[data-type*=select-one].is-open:after{border:none;margin-top:-10px;transform:rotate(180deg)}.stock-display .choices__inner,.stock-display .is-open .choices__inner{border-radius:4px}.stock-display .choices__list--dropdown,.stock-display .choices__list[aria-expanded]{border-color:#e2e2e2;border-radius:4px;margin-top:4px;padding:4px}.stock-display .choices__list--dropdown .choices__item--selectable.is-highlighted,.stock-display .choices__list[aria-expanded] .choices__item--selectable.is-highlighted{background-color:transparent}.stock-display .choices__list--dropdown .choices__item--selectable.is-highlighted:hover,.stock-display .choices__list[aria-expanded] .choices__item--selectable.is-highlighted:hover,.stock-display .choices__item.is-selected{background-color:#f4f4f4}.stock-display .choices__list--dropdown .choices__item--selectable:has(.out-of-stock) .store-name,.stock-display .choices__list[aria-expanded] .choices__item--selectable:has(.out-of-stock) .store-name{color:#76777b}.stock-display__label.status-available:before{content:"";display:inline-block;width:8px;height:8px;border-radius:50%;background-color:#68c090;margin-right:8px}.stock-display__label.status-unavailable:before{content:"";display:inline-block;width:8px;height:8px;border-radius:50%;background-color:#cf102d;margin-right:8px}
/*# sourceMappingURL=/cdn/shop/t/573/assets/component-stock-display.css.map */
